Crafting the Character through Closet and Props

The change process is where the magic really begins to take shape. This is not about easy dress-up; it is about premium costumes and handmade devices. Studios concentrating on Pricing & Investment | Enchanted Fairies Fairy Photoshoot provide a curated wardrobe that consists of everything from ethereal fairy dresses to strong knight armor. Each piece is selected for its texture and how it engages with the light, ensuring that the last image looks like a painting come to life.

The hand-crafted wings utilized in these sessions are especially outstanding. Far from the plastic variations discovered in toy stores, these are intricate pieces of art themselves, designed with rainbowlike materials that catch the light in specific methods. When a kid puts on these wings or selects up a captivating prop like a radiant lantern or a silver sword, their attitude changes. They stop positioning and start playing. This shift is what enables an expert photographer to catch the marvel that defines childhood.

The Art of the Session and Interaction

Throughout a session, the professional photographer functions as a quiet observer and a gentle guide. Instead of demanding a smile, they might ask a child to look for hidden crystals amongst the moss-covered trees of the forest set. This interaction is designed to spark curiosity. The sets are developed with such detail-- featuring sensible foliage and climatic lighting-- that kids frequently forget they are in a studio at all.

This approach requires persistence and a deep understanding of kid psychology. The objective is to catch the exact 2nd when a kid's eyes illuminate or when they become lost in thought. These are the frames that ultimately end up being the centerpiece of a household's home. The technical side of the session, including complex lighting setups to mimic a forest canopy, takes place behind the scenes so that the kid can remain focused on their "mission" or their role in the storybook world.

Post-Production and Archival Standards

The work continues long after the child has actually left the studio. Each picked picture undergoes a detailed hand-retouching process performed by professional artists. These artists don't simply fix technical flaws; they improve the image to provide it a painterly quality. They might deepen the shadows to include drama or highlight the sparkle of a fairy wing to stress the magical style. This level of craftsmanship guarantees that each piece is unique.

Durability is a main issue for collectors of fine art portraiture. In 2026, using archival-grade paper and specialized inks is the standard for these high-end items. These materials are tested to ensure they stay lovely for over 100 years. Whether the last product is a framed wall portrait, a gallery-wrapped canvas, or a custom storybook, the focus is on resilience. These are meant to be given through the household, working as a permanent record of a kid's imagination at a particular moment.
